Question Deadline 10/06/2023 at 4:00 PM ET Questions regarding the Plans and Bid Documents shall be submitted via the "Clarifications" feature in PennBid Tri-Municipal Park, Inc. requests bids for construction at Penns Prairie at Tri-Municipal Park. Penns Prairie at Tri-Municipal Park is a public park serving residents from throughout the region. The scope of work for the Park will include the construction of the following: o Pavilion Structure o Installation of Traditional and Nature Playground o Constructing an ADA Accessible Trail o Gravel Parking Area w/ ADA Accessible Parking Spaces and Accessible Route Penns Prairie at Tri-Municipal Park is a 165-acre public park accessed by Upper Brush Valley Road, west of Centre Hall Borough, in Potter Township, Centre County, PA. The Park construction site is limited to 25 acres in the northeast corner of the park site, and is graphically indicated within the construction documents plan set on sheets 1, 2 and 3. The Contractors and or Subcontractors are required to submit a Contractor's Qualifications Statement and a list of relevant completed projects and references with their bid detailing a minimum of five years of experience in site grading and park, recreation and trail development work. Contractors may bid on all or part of the work outlined in the scope of this project Each Proposal shall be accompanied by a cashiers check, certified check, or bid bond in an amount equal to ten percent (10%) of the total amount of the bid price The anticipated Notice to Proceed date is December 1, 2023. The project shall be completed by May 31, 2024.
